What you’ll do As a Partner Solution Architect within the Wholesale team is a technical authority for the design, implementation and change of the technical service delivery architecture to VodafoneThree UK MVNO partners. The Partner Solution Architect will design fit for purpose solutions that align with VodafoneThree architectural principles and ensure that such designs receive Network and IT architecture approval as relevant. The Partner Solution Consultant will report to the Partner Solutions Manager.
- Designing End to End solutions for the evolution of MVNO partner capabilities in alignment with Vodafone architectural principles, and then working with UK and Group technology functions to deliver those designs on behalf of and in alignment with the MVNO partners;
- Design, document and deliver End to End solutions, requirements or processes as appropriate for new MVNO opportunities into the Vodafone estate;
- Assess the impacts of technology designs on Wholesale/MVNO business and capabilities. Provide guidance on these solutions to ensure alignment with MVNO architectures. Influence changes to organisation, process and technology accordingly;
- Build rapport with the MVNO partners technical teams, relevant 3rd party vendors, and VodafoneThree Design and Delivery teams to ensure cost-effective and efficient design, testing and integration of partner deliverables;
- Lead delivery across IT and Networks for MVNO technical changes.
Who you are
- Architecture & Design: 3+ experience of Defining and eliciting MVNO Partners and/or VodafoneThree teams needs and translating them to requirements and solution design, aligned to business strategic objectives and constraints. Contributes to defining current and future strategies and evolution roadmap.
- Technology: Thorough understanding of both network and IT architecture components;
- APIs: Understanding of SOA to facilitate domain-driven design, identifying appropriate interaction frameworks that enable scalability and agility for MVNO partners.
- Security: Incorporates secure by design principles when designing, building, testing solutions, products and services.
- Communication: Ability to communicate effectively to all levels within VodafoneThree, MVNO Partners, and external suppliers;
